diff --git a/app/react/edge/edge-stacks/ListView/EdgeStacksDatatable/EdgeStacksStatus.tsx b/app/react/edge/edge-stacks/ListView/EdgeStacksDatatable/EdgeStacksStatus.tsx index 280ee8d77..565eac41e 100644 --- a/app/react/edge/edge-stacks/ListView/EdgeStacksDatatable/EdgeStacksStatus.tsx +++ b/app/react/edge/edge-stacks/ListView/EdgeStacksDatatable/EdgeStacksStatus.tsx @@ -65,7 +65,7 @@ function getStatus( }; } - if (envStatus.length < numDeployments) { + if (!envStatus.length) { return { label: 'Deploying', icon: Loader2, @@ -84,6 +84,15 @@ function getStatus( }; } + if (envStatus.length < numDeployments) { + return { + label: 'Deploying', + icon: Loader2, + spin: true, + mode: 'primary', + }; + } + const allCompleted = envStatus.every((s) => s.Type === StatusType.Completed); if (allCompleted) {